Icy roads caused multiple crashes and temporary highway closures in Utah on Monday, officials reported.
There were at least 84 crashes statewide Monday morning since midnight, according to the Utah Highway Patrol. Most were in northern Utah.
I-15 and U.S. Highway 6 experienced temporary closures early Monday, and traffic remained delayed after I-15 reopened along the Wasatch Front.
The Little Cottonwood Canyon road to two ski resorts also was briefly closed for avalanche control on Monday morning, which was a holiday and traditionally a busy ski day.
